Matt Maiocco, San Francisco 49ers reporter for NBC Sports Bay Area, joined Cattles and Ramie on Tuesday to talk about the coaching news that broke around the NFL and pontificated who the next starting quarterback for the 49ers could be next season.
Topics discussed include:
- How much will the absence of DeMeco Ryans impact the 49ers’ defense?
- Who are the top replacement candidates to fill the role of Defensive Coordinator?
- How possible is it that the 49ers swoop in and hire Vic Fangio away from the Miami Dolphins?
- “I know that back in 2017, Kyle Shanahan wanted to hire Vic Fangio as his Defensive Coordinator. He’s an admirer of Fangio and it would surprise me if they haven’t had those conversations and kind of figured out, both sides, which way they want to go with this.”
- Why Shanahan’s plan is to probably stick with people who run his system
- How close were the 49ers to riding Brock Purdy into the starting position next season?
- “I would say that Brock Purdy proved that he’s the quarterback of the future by being the quarterback of the present.”
- As of this point, Trey Lance is back this offseason and is running the first-team reps until Brock Purdy is ready to go.
- If veterans like Tom Brady or Aaron Rodgers are viable options for the San Francisco 49ers.
